RangerSteven wrote:So you can't just have "type of button" or some such as part of the clothing item's definition?
No we can't without additional programing. The way it is set up now is that we have to have a set amount and kind of material for each project. If you want glass beads on a hemp dress for instance then the resource requirements would have to be changed, and that is not possible the way it is set up right now.
We can do like Seko said and add a new project for a specific kind of clothing that you suggest, but it cannot be user selected in the game without something changed in the programing.
